BIODEG GREENCARD |
(Biodegradation) |
| DATABASE DESCRIPTION : | |
| BIODEG was developed through the collaborative efforts of the EPA's Office of Toxic Substances and the Syracuse Research Corporation (SRC). It contains information concerning the biodegradation of chemical substances in a variety of types of experiments and under a variety of experimental conditions (e.g., aerobic, anaerobic, etc.) | |

| DATABASE DATA : | |
| Inclusive Dates: | Through 1989 (current version as of 8/96) |
| Update Frequency: | Closed file, no longer updated |
| Size: | Over 6,600 records with information about the biodegradation of 815 chemical substances |
| ORIGIN : | |
| EPA's Office of Toxic Substances and the Syracuse Research Corporation (SRC). | |
